Hydrogen: The Strategic Imperative for Heavy Transport
The push for hydrogen in heavy-duty transport is driven by an undeniable economic and environmental imperative. Unlike battery electric vehicles, which face limitations in range, payload, and charging times for long-haul trucking, hydrogen fuel cells offer a compelling alternative. They provide quick refueling, extended range, and sustained power output, making them ideal for the rigorous demands of logistics operations. The European H2Haul project, featuring Daimler Truck’s collaboration with DHL Freight and the BMW Group, is a prime example of this strategic focus. By putting two hydrogen-powered trucks into real-world operation, the partners are moving beyond theoretical models to practical validation. This pilot test aims to rigorously evaluate the day-to-day practicality and operational efficiency of hydrogen fuel cells in heavy-duty applications, an essential step in building the confidence required for widespread commercial adoption and significant capital deployment into hydrogen infrastructure and vehicle fleets.

Forging Alliances: The Path to Scalable Hydrogen Infrastructure
The success of hydrogen mobility, especially for heavy-duty applications, hinges not only on vehicle technology but also on the rapid development of a robust fueling infrastructure. Daimler Truck’s collaboration with DHL Freight and the BMW Group underscores the critical importance of multi-stakeholder partnerships in overcoming the chicken-and-egg problem of hydrogen adoption. DHL Freight’s commitment as a “pioneer in eco-friendly logistics” and its openness to “forward-looking cooperations” highlights the industry-wide recognition that no single entity can build this ecosystem alone. These alliances are vital for sharing the immense capital expenditure required for hydrogen production, distribution, and refueling stations.
